Temporary pop-up islands and food boats during Rotte PICNIC ISLAND

20-4-2016

Time for some summer fun in Rotterdam during the Rotte PICNIC ISLAND. From 1 to 3 July you can enjoy food, drinks, music, art and culture here. All on one of the two temporary islands floating around in the Rotte river. Food will be served among other from food boats.

Deliveroo opens pop-up restaurant

18-4-2016

Last saturday the 16th of April opened Deliveroo opened a pop-up restaurant in Amsterdam. Deliveroo is the first delivery service that opens a pop-up restaurant in the Netherlands. For a week the delivery service presents the biggest menu of the Netherlands in the Kalverstraat. Amsterdam’s favorite restaurants as The Butcher, Cafe George, Max and Anne & Max serve their dishes under one roof in one of the busiest shopping streets.
